A zero balance account (ZBA) is exactly what it sounds like: a checking account in which a balance of $0 is maintained. When funds are needed in the ZBA, the exact amount of money required is automatically transferred from a central or master account. Similarly, deposits are swept into the master account … See more The master account provides a centralized place to manage an organization's funds. Whenever funds are required in the ZBA checking accountto … See more Transactions from ZBAs are self-managed, often saving the account holder time for having to manually rebalance or fund transactions. ZBAs may also be easier to reconcile, audit, or receive department-level … See more An organization may have multiple zero balance accounts to improve budget management and make the process of allocating funds more efficient. This can include creating a … See more Not everyone can qualify for a ZBA. Banks will often not offer this product to general consumers and will only offer this solution to companies. WebMay 22, 2024 · A payroll clearing account is a temporary, zero-balance account. That is, once you've paid your payroll, the journal entry will "zero out" leaving no balance. A zero balance account is a business checking account that maintains a balance of zero by sweeping funds into and out of a main account. But as per me, we can only define one GL Account per Chart of Account for zero balancing. bs7 gym classesWebA clearing account, also known as a wash account, is a temporary account in which the funds are kept to get smoothly transferred to the required account when the transfer cannot be done directly from one … bs7p-shf-1aaWebThe system checks whether the balance of account assignment object (Profit Center, Segment) is zero after document splitting. If this is not the case, the system generates additional clearing items. In this activity, you have to create a clearing account for these additional clearing items.
